Subject: bug#39689: 26.3; browse-url-mail not supporting RFC6068 (UTF-8-Based Percent-Encoding)
Date: Thu, 20 Feb 2020 14:48:54 +0100 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1sd0a9tlmh.fsf@uninett.no> (raw)
Emacs does not seem to correctly handle UTF-8-Based Percent-Encoding as
illustrated in Chapter 6.2 from RFC6068.
The command
emacs -Q -l browse-url -eval '(browse-url-mail "mailto:user@example.org?subject=caf%C3%A9&body=caf%C3%A9")'
should result in a message buffer with the string "café" insterted into the
body part of the message. Instead the string "café" is inserted.
I am running Ubuntu 18.04.3 LTS.
M-x emacs-version returns:
"GNU Emacs 26.3 (build 2, x86_64-pc-linux-gnu, GTK+ Version 3.22.30) of 2019-09-16"
